All primed for Asiad


Strong legs: Women cyclists Anis Amira Rosidi (left) and Farina Shawati Mohd Adnan posing with their medals at the Dublin Track Cycling International meet in Ireland.

PETALING JAYA: Women cyclists Farina Shawati Mohd Adnan and Anis Amira Rosidi proved they are primed for a good outing in their Asian Games campaign in Indonesia next month by finishing on the podium in the Dublin Track Cycling International meet in Ireland.

Farina won the women’s elite keirin final contest ahead of Italian Maila Andreotti and Britain’s Lucy Grant. Her teammate Anis finished fourth.
